Certified Agile Auditor (CAA)

This certification is a testimonial of a professional auditor on the competence in performing audits using agile methods, to add better value to the stakeholders. 

A conventional auditor does the audit in a waterfall model. With the changing environments and changing organisational methods of dealing with various activities, the audit methods also should change and agile enough to meet the current high velocity and dynamic scenarios. Audit activities must deliver  value to the stakeholders and enable them to make decisions. In a rapidly changing environment how an organisation is going to get value from the audit activities is what Agile Auditing deals with. Adoption of agile methods to auditing enhances the value of audits to relevant stakeholders. This certification deals with how agile auditing can be performed and the value it can bring to the organisation.

Certification examination

​

Blooms taxonomy levels 2 - 5 (Mixed)

Multiple choice single answer questions, including case study based

 50 (35+15) Questions | 120 Minutes | Computer based
